               WHEREAS:
               -------


A.   Sinovac Biotech Co., Ltd.  (hereinafter  referred to as the "Company") is a
body  corporate  subsisting  under and  registered  pursuant  to the laws of the
People's Republic of China and is also majority owned (51%) by the Purchaser;


B.   The Purchaser is in the business of research and  development  specializing
in the development and manufacturing of various vaccines  including flu vaccines
and vaccines for hepatitis A, hepatitis B and hepatitis A&B  (collectively,  the
"Purchaser's Business")


C.   Bioway  is the  legal  and  beneficial  owner of  13,000,000  shares of the
Company,  representing  9.73%  of the  issued  and  outstanding  shares  (each a
"Purchased  Share") in the capital of the  Company as set forth in Schedule  "A"
which is attached hereto and which forms a material part hereof;


D.   Keding  is the  legal  and  beneficial  owner of  3,890,000  shares  of the
Company,  representing  2.91%  of the  issued  and  outstanding  shares  (each a
"Purchased  Share") in the capital of the  Company as set forth in Schedule  "A"
which is attached hereto and which forms a material part hereof;


E.   Shenzhen  is the legal and  beneficial  owner of  10,580,000  shares of the
Company,  representing  7.92%  of the  issued  and  outstanding  shares  (each a
"Purchased  Share") in the capital of the  Company as set forth in Schedule  "A"
which is attached hereto and which forms a material part hereof;


F.   The Parties hereto have agreed to enter into this Share Purchase  Agreement
(the "Agreement") which formalizes and clarifies the Parties'  respective duties
and  obligations  in  connection  with the purchase by the  Purchaser,  from the
Vendors,  of the Purchased  Shares together with the further  development of the
Company's Business as a consequence thereof;

                                    Article 2
                                    ---------
              PURCHASE AND SALE OF THE ALL OF THE PURCHASED SHARES
              ----------------------------------------------------

2.1    Purchase and Sale.   Subject to the terms and conditions hereof and based
       ------------------
upon the  representations  and  warranties  contained  in  Articles  "3" and "4"
hereinbelow  and prior  satisfaction  of the conditions  precedent which are set
forth in Article "5" hereinbelow,  the Vendors hereby agree to assign,  sell and
transfer at the Closing Date (as hereinafter determined) all of their respective
rights,  entitlement and interest in and to the Purchased  Shares in the Company
to the  Purchaser  and  the  Purchaser  hereby  agrees  to  purchase  all of the
Purchased  Shares from the  Vendors on the terms and  subject to the  conditions
contained in this Agreement.

2.2    Purchase  Price.   The  total purchase  price (the "Purchase  Price") for
       ----------------
all of the  Purchased  Shares will be satisfied by way of payment in cash in the
amounts of  US$1,570,000  to Bioway,  US$470,000 to Keding and  US$1,270,000  to
Shenzhen at closing.

                                    Article 6
                                    ---------
                          CLOSING AND EVENTS OF CLOSING
                          -----------------------------

6.1    Closing and Closing  Date.    The closing (the  "Closing")  of the within
       --------------------------
purchase and delivery of the Purchased  Shares, as contemplated in the manner as
set forth in Article  "2"  hereinabove,  together  with all of the  transactions
contemplated  by this  Agreement  shall occur on December 30, 2004 (the "Closing
Date"),  or on such earlier or later Closing Date as may be agreed to in advance
and in writing by each of the Parties hereto,  and will be closed at the offices
of solicitors for the  Purchaser,  Devlin  Jensen,  Barristers  and  Solicitors,
located at Suite 2550 - 555 W. Hastings St.,  Vancouver,  B.C., V6B 4N5, at 2:00
p.m. (Vancouver time) on the Closing Date.

6.2    Latest Closing Date.  If the Closing Date has not occurred by January 30,
       --------------------
2005,  subject to an extension as may be mutually agreed to by the Parties for a
maximum of 14 days per extension,  then the Purchaser and the Vendors shall each
have the option to terminate this Agreement by delivery of written notice to the
other Party.  Upon delivery of such notice,  this Agreement shall cease to be of
any force and effect except for Article "8"  hereinbelow,  which shall remain in
full force and effect notwithstanding the termination of this Agreement.

                                   Article 11
                                   ----------
                                   ARBITRATION
                                   -----------

11.1   Matters for Arbitration.  The Parties agree that all questions or matters
       ------------------------
in dispute with  respect to this  Agreement  shall be  submitted to  arbitration
pursuant to the terms hereof.

11.2   Notice.   It shall be a condition precedent to the  right of any Party to
       -------
submit any matter to  arbitration  pursuant  to the  provisions  hereof that any
Party  intending  to refer any matter to  arbitration  shall have given not less
than 10 calendar  days' prior  written  notice of its  intention to do so to the
other  Party  together  with  particulars  of  the  matter  in  dispute.  On the
expiration  of such 10 calendar  days the Party who gave such notice may proceed
to refer the dispute to arbitration as provided in section "11.3" hereinbelow.

11.3    Appointments.    The   Party  desiring  arbitration  shall  appoint  one
        -------------
arbitrator, and shall notify the other Party of such appointment,  and the other
Party shall,  within two calendar days after  receiving such notice,  appoint an
arbitrator,  and the two arbitrators so named,  before proceeding to act, shall,
within 10 calendar days of the  appointment  of the last  appointed  arbitrator,
unanimously agree on the appointment of a third arbitrator, to act with them and
be chairman of the  arbitration  herein  provided  for. If the other Party shall
fail to appoint an arbitrator  within 10 calendar days after receiving notice of



<PAGE>


                                       18



the appointment of the first arbitrator, and if the two arbitrators appointed by
the Parties shall be unable to agree on the  appointment  of the  chairman,  the
chairman shall be appointed  under the provisions of the Commercial  Arbitration
Act (British Columbia) (the "Arbitration Act"). Except as specifically otherwise
provided in this section, the arbitration herein provided for shall be conducted
in accordance with such Arbitration Act. The chairman, or in the case where only
one arbitrator is appointed,  the single arbitrator,  shall fix a time and place
in  Vancouver,  British  Columbia,  for the purpose of hearing the  evidence and
representations  of the Parties,  and he shall preside over the  arbitration and
determine all questions of procedure not provided for under such Arbitration Act
or this section. After hearing any evidence and representations that the Parties
may submit, the single arbitrator, or the arbitrators, as the case may be, shall
make an award and reduce the same to writing,  and  deliver one copy  thereof to
each of the Parties.  The expense of the arbitration  shall be paid as specified
in the award.

11.4   Award.    The  Parties  agree  that  the  award  of  a  majority  of  the
       ------
arbitrators, or in the case of a single arbitrator, of such arbitrator, shall be
final and binding upon each of them.
